1. Courtallam Waterfalls

Courtallam Waterfalls, Tamil Nadu

Courtallam is one of the important waterfalls in Tamil Nadu. The nearest city of Courtallam is Tenkasi. So, one can easily get the proper transport facility from this place. However, the distance between Courtallam and Tenkadi is almost 7 km. You will enjoy the scenic beauty of the waterfalls.

The mesmerising weather and wonderful waterfalls will make you fall in love. However, the height of the waterfall is almost 550 feet. The water is so clean that you can easily take a bath over here. Chittraru river is the source of this waterfall.  There are lots of places to click snaps and make it special.

2. Monkey Waterfalls

Monkey Waterfalls, Coimbatore, Tamil Nadu

If you are going to Coimbatore then please visit Monkey falls. It is almost 30 km away from the main city Pollachi. Several types of movie shooting happen here. The water is very healthy to take a bath in. We all know that the weather of Tamil Nadu remains cool in the winter season.

The best time to visit here is between November to May. The main attraction of Monkey falls is the small pool. If you get scared to bathe in the falls, then use the pools. The pool is open from 12 pm to 3 pm. You can enjoy it only in these few hours.

3. Agaya Gangai Waterfalls

Agaya Gangai Waterfalls, Tamil Nadu

If you visit Agaya Gangai waterfalls then you can see the waterfalls as well as the Kolli hills. The source of these waterfalls is Kolli hills. This waterfall is often termed the death pool. That’s why you have to maintain proper balance while visiting here.

The reason for it is that you have to climb 1200+ steps to reach the waterfalls. Older people should avoid it. The young people can climb it easily. However, coming down is very difficult. That’s why many people try to avoid it.

4. Siruvani Waterfalls

Siruvani Waterfalls, Coimbatore, Tamil Nadu

The western is itself the beauty of India. Siruvani waterfall is located in Coimbatore district in the western ghat. This is the best place for family members and friends to visit. You will get a thrill and it is wonderful to visit here. The water is so clean that you can take a bath in it.

Besides the waterfalls, there are also other forests. So, people can enjoy the scenic beauty of Siruvani waterfalls as well as the forest. The main thing is that the road is slippery. So, one needs to be very cautious in this case.

5. Agasthiyar Waterfalls

Agasthiyar Waterfalls (Papanasam), Tamil Nadu

Agasthiyar falls are also known as Papanasam falls. The origin of this waterfall is the Thamirabarani river. This waterfall is located in the Tirunelveli district. Several cascades fall, which is why they will never dry up. Mythology says that Shiva and Parvati got married in Kailash.

After their marriage, the sage Agasthiyar pray for this couple. The water is very healthy. So, if you take a bath here, it will help to grow your immune system. Another attraction of these falls is the various types of monkeys. These monkeys are slightly different from the other monkeys.

6. Kodiveri Waterfalls

Kodiveri Waterfalls, Tamil Nadu

Kodiveri waterfalls are located in Erode. This is the best waterfall that one should visit in their lifetime. The best time to spend here is in the summer. The cool breeze and the healthy waterfall will cure many of your diseases. The place is open so that no one can get hurt. It is perfect for women and children.

The nearest city to Kodiveri waterfalls is Sathyamangalam. However, don’t forget to ride the coracle ride. It is the most impressive view. Try to avoid this waterfall in the winter. It is because the water level rises high. Lots of travellers visit this waterfall daily.

7. Thirumoorthy Waterfalls

Thirumoorthy Waterfalls, Tamil Nadu

Thirumoorthy falls is located between Thirumoorthy dam and the Thirumoorthy temple. So, if you come to visit this waterfall then you can get to see the temple as well as the dam. You should avoid the summer season and try to visit here in the winter and rainy seasons. The waterfall will not be great in summer.

That’s why it’s better to avoid that place. The cool breeze and the mesmerizing scenery will make you believe that you are staying in heaven. The members of this waterfall maintain strict discipline. If the waterfall is high then they don’t allow the travellers to view it. The dress changing rooms are available. It is safe for women and children.

9. Hogenakkal Waterfalls

Hogenakkal Waterfalls, Tamil Nadu

The source of Hogenakkal falls is none other than the Kaveri river. This waterfall is located in the Dharmapuri district. It is one of the best waterfalls. Other people also refer to it as Niagara falls. It is approximately 2200 feet high. The water is very clean and clear. By taking a bath over here, you will feel great.

You will find a separate place both for boating and bathing. Besides the waterfalls, you will also find a good canteen for the travellers at an affordable price. Don’t forget to ride the boat. Remember that boat riding is not available in the monsoon timing.

10. Thirparappu Waterfalls

Thirparappu Waterfalls, Tamil Nadu

Another important waterfall that we have included in our list is none other than Thirparappu waterfalls. This waterfall is situated in Kanyakumari. This is one of the best tourist spots. People can visit this waterfall from 9 am to 5 pm. The water is very clean. You can enjoy these waterfalls with your family or with friends.

However, this waterfall is not as popular as the other. Many people don’t know about it. The place is safe. Women and children will enjoy coming here. The best part is that the waterfall also has a beautiful park for the children.
